New API Electron Desktop App

This directory contains the Electron wrapper for New API, providing a native desktop application with system tray support for Windows, macOS, and Linux.

Prerequisites

1. Go Binary (Required)

The Electron app requires the compiled Go binary to function. You have two options:

Option A: Use existing binary (without Go installed)

# If you have a pre-built binary (e.g., new-api-macos)
cp ../new-api-macos ../new-api

3. Electron Dependencies

cd electron
npm install

Development

Run the app in development mode:

npm start

This will:

  • Start the Go backend on port 3000
  • Open an Electron window with DevTools enabled
  • Create a system tray icon (menu bar on macOS)
  • Store database in ../data/new-api.db

Building for Production

Quick Build

# Ensure Go binary exists in parent directory
ls ../new-api  # Should exist

# Build for current platform
npm run build

# Platform-specific builds
npm run build:mac    # Creates .dmg and .zip
npm run build:win    # Creates .exe installer
npm run build:linux  # Creates .AppImage and .deb

Build Output

  • Built applications are in electron/dist/
  • macOS: .dmg (installer) and .zip (portable)
  • Windows: .exe (installer) and portable exe
  • Linux: .AppImage and .deb

Configuration

Port

Default port is 3000. To change, edit main.js:

const PORT = 3000; // Change to desired port

Database Location

  • Development: ../data/new-api.db (project directory)
  • Production:
    • macOS: ~/Library/Application Support/New API/data/
    • Windows: %APPDATA%/New API/data/
    • Linux: ~/.config/New API/data/
